找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 1602|回复: 3
打印 上一主题 下一主题
收起左侧

汇编语言问题,初学汇编,麻烦看看蓝色注释有什么问题吗 红色字体什么意思

[复制链接]
回帖奖励 9 黑币 回复本帖可获得 3 黑币奖励! 每人限 1 次
跳转到指定楼层
楼主
ID:433060 发表于 2019-4-8 20:37 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
DATA SEGMENT       
ORG 0300H
A DB 12H,23H,34H,45H,56H,67H,78H,89H,9AH
DATA ENDS
CODE SEGMENT
ASSUME CS:CODE,DS:DATA
START:  MOV AX,DATA
        MOV DS,AX;不能将立即数直接传给段寄存器DS,应先将DATA传送给AX,再通过AX将数值传送给段寄存器DS
        MOV AX,BX;将寄存器BX中的内容传送给寄存器AX中
        MOV AX,0300H;采用立即寻址方式,将立即数0300H存于AX寄存器中
        MOV AX,[0300H];以直接寻址方式访问数据12H
        MOV AX,[BX];以寄存器间接寻址方式将地址为DS:BX存储单元中的数复制到AX寄存器中
        MOV SI,2
        MOV AX,0001[BX]
        MOV AX,[BX][SI];基址变址寻址方式
        MOV AX,0001[BX][SI]
        MOV AH,4CH
        INT 21H
CODE ENDS
        END START

分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 分享淘帖 顶 踩
回复

使用道具 举报

沙发
ID:123289 发表于 2019-4-9 08:47 | 只看该作者
查看CPU的指令系统就一目了然了。
回复

使用道具 举报

板凳
ID:351489 发表于 2019-4-9 10:34 来自手机 | 只看该作者
红色的是有问题的
回复

使用道具 举报

地板
ID:349067 发表于 2019-4-9 16:33 | 只看该作者
红色部分不就是定义了几个16进制数吗?
蓝色部分的注释很好
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表